The "Operation Atlantic" jointly launched by law enforcement agencies from the US, UK, and Canada has recently made significant progress. The operation was coordinated in March by the UK's National Crime Agency (NCA), the US Secret Service, and Ontario Provincial Police, aiming to combat "Approval Phishing" scams. The operation identified over 20,000 victims, involving stolen funds exceeding $45 million, and successfully froze approximately $12 million in illicit proceeds. (Cointelegraph)
